A philosopher rabbi religious historian & Gnostic Jacob Taubes was for many years a correspondent & interlocutor of Carl Schmitt (1888--1985) a German jurist philosopher political theorist law professor -- & self-professed Nazi. Despite their unlikely association Taubes & Schmitt shared an abiding interest in the fundamental problems of political theology believing the great challenges of modern political theory were ancient in pedigree & in many cases anticipated the works of Judeo-Christian eschatologists. In this collection of Taubes's writings on Schmitt the two intellectuals work through ideas of the apocalypse & other central concepts of political theology. Taubes acknowledges Schmitt's reservations about the weakness of liberal democracy yet distances himself from his prescription to rectify it arguing the apocalyptic worldview requires less of a rigid hierarchical social ordering than a community committed to the importance of decision making. In these writings a sharper & more nuanced portrait of Schmitt's thought emerges as well as a more complicated understanding of Taubes who has shaped the work of Giorgio Agamben Peter Sloterdijk & other major twentieth-century theorists. ...

To Beguile A Beast

Sir Alistair Munroe is a naturalist knighted for his service to the crown during the French and Indian War - a war that left him horribly maimed. Because of his scars he lives a near solitary existence in a crumbling Scottish castle. Until a dark and stormy night when he opens the door to a buxom beauty claiming to be his new housekeeper. Helen Fitzwilliam has led a life full of mistakes not least among them spending the last ten years as mistress to the Duke of Lister a man without any kindness. But when the duke takes a new younger mistress Helen makes a decision she knows isnt a mistake. She leaves the duke taking with her their two young children. Knowing that Lister hates to give up anything--even a mistress hes cast aside--Helen flees to Scotland and the home of a man shes never met.
These two wounded souls find an undeniable passion and love in each others arms but the bliss of their relationship isnt to last. The Duke steals his children away from Helen forcing her to reveal her true past to Alistair and a friend from Alistairs army past is back from the dead--and quite possibly involved in the betrayal that lead to the massacre of their regiment
